cpu-protection
Syntax cpu-protection policy-id [mac-monitoring]|[eth-cfm-monitoring [aggregate][car]] |[ip-
src-monitoring]
no cpu-protection
Context config>service>ies>interface>sap
config>service>ies>interface>spoke-sdp
config>service>ies>sub-if>grp-if>sap
config>service>vprn>interface>sap
config>service>vprn>interface>spoke-sdp
config>service>vprn>sub-if>grp-if>sap
Description Use this command to apply a specific CPU protection policy to the associated msap-policy. The
specified cpu-protection policy will automatically be applied to any MSAPs that are create using the
msap-policy.
If no CPU-protection policy is assigned to a SAP, then a default policy is used to limit the overall-rate
according to the default policy. The default policy is policy number 254 for access interfaces, 255 for
network interfaces and no policy for video interfaces.
The no form of the command reverts to the default values.
Default cpu-protection 254 (for access interfaces)
cpu-protection 255 (for network interfaces)
The configuration of no cpu-protection returns the msap-policy to the default policies as shown
above.
Parameters mac-monitoring — Enables per SAP + source MAC address rate limiting using the per-source-rate
from the associated cpu-protection policy.
ip-src-monitoring — Enables per SAP + IP source address rate limiting for certain protocol packets
using the per-source-rate and include-protocols from the associated cpu-protection policy. The ip-src-
monitoring is useful in subscriber management architectures that have routers between the subscriber
and the BNG (router). In layer-3 aggregation scenarios all packets from all subscribers behind the
same aggregation router will arrive with the same source MAC address and as such the mac-monitor-
ing functionality can not differentiate traffic from different subscribers.
eth-cfm-monitoring — Enables the Ethernet Connectivity Fault Management cpu-protection
extensions on the associated SAP/SDP/template.
